Excellent shopping centre. This place has all the main shops in one convenient location. There is excellent value parking also. It's possible to get 3 hours for only 2 euro. One point though - do not park on the upper open car park near tesco if you want to get this deal. Perfect for Christmas shopping. They have a lovely creche here too. The restaurants can be a little expensive. Probably best to go early in the morning in the busy Christmas season.... Read more...

This is my favourite shopping centre in Dublin. It is the one stop shopping centre with a shop to cater for everyones needs. It has a huge multi story car park. It can be very busy and at peak times can be difficult to find parking, its one of the few shopping centres that provide mother and toddler parking spaces close to the doors and twin toddler shopping trollys a must when you have two young children. the shops range from the good value Pennys to the higher end House of Fraser.
